IB/ipoib: Avoid multicast join attempts with invalid P_key



Currently, the parent interface keeps sending broadcast group join
requests even if p_key index 0 is invalid, which is possible/common in
virtualized environments where a VF has been probed to VM but the
actual P_key configuration has not yet been assigned by the management
software. This creates unnecessary noise on the fabric and in the
kernel logs:

    ib0: multicast join failed for ff12:401b:8000:0000:0000:0000:ffff:ffff, status -22

The original code run the multicast task regardless of the actual
P_key value, which can be avoided. The fix is to re-init resources and
bring interface up only if P_key index 0 is valid either when starting
up or on PKEY_CHANGE event.

Fixes: c2904141 ("IPoIB: Fix pkey change flow for virtualization environments")
